High-tech HCMC treatments
Thủ Đức District Hospital doctors perform transarterial chemoembolization (TACE) for the first time to treat a patient with a malignant liver tumour. Photo Thủ Đức District Hospital. Viet Nam News HCM CITY — District-level hospitals in HCM City are now using more advanced techniques and treatment, often performing at a level that matches city-level hospitals. The Thủ Đức District Hospital, which is considered only the district-level hospital in HCM City with the same quality as city-level hospitals, has successfully performed for the first time the non-surgical treatment, transarterial chemoembolization (TACE), on a patient with a malignant liver tumour. The 58-year-old patient was hospitalised and diagnosed on May 12. During TACE, the doctors injected a chemotherapy medication into the patient’s liver through a catheter inserted into a femoral artery to prevent the development of the cancerous tumour. Hòa Lạc Hi-tech Park to get update
Sci-fi: An artist’s impression of Hòa Lạc Hi-tech Park planned for Hà Nội’s Thăng Long Boulevard. Photo tapchitaichinh.vn Viet Nam News HÀ NỘI – Prime Minister Nguyễn Xuân Phúc has approved updated plans for Hòa Lạc High-tech Park, to be completed by 2030 in Hà Nội’s outlying districts of Thạch Thất and Quốc Oai. The Hòa Lạc Hi-tech Park, approved in 1998, is the first and the largest hi-tech facility in Việt Nam with total area of 1,586 ha. The park is located along Hà Nội’s Thăng Long Boulevard, convenient for transport links to Nội Bài International Airport and Hải Phòng deep-sea port. It is expected to become a model science city and a national hub for technology development and application. About 12,600 people are currently living and working in the park, and by 2030 the park’s population is expected to reach 229,000, half of which will be permanent residents. Research centre on high-tech education to be built at Sài Gòn Hi-Tech Park
Sài Gòn Hi-Tech Park on Wednesday granted a license to HCM City Open University to build a research centre for high-tech education. — Photo Courtesy of HCM City Open University Viet Nam News HCM CITY — Sài Gòn Hi-Tech Park on Wednesday granted an investment license to HCM City Open University to build a research centre specialising in education technologies in District 9. With total capital of VNĐ290 billion (US$12.7 million), the 8,985-sq m centre will include labs where researchers will create as many as 176 kinds of software for e-learning and learning management systems. The research centre for development of high-tech education will also offer e-learning and technical training, including for post-graduates, with the aim of serving 2,400 people each year. Ninh Bình farmers reap hi-tech agriculture benefits
Farmers take care of vegetables planted in a greenhouse in Ninh Bình Province’s Yên Khánh District. — Photo baoninhbinh.org.vn Viet Nam News NINH BÌNH – Hi-tech agriculture has helped Ninh Bình farmers earn more profit even though they have to invest more in cultivation, local reports say. In the northern province’s Yên Khánh District, 40 households in Khánh Hồng Commune joined in a 2014 programme to grow vegetables with technical support from the provincial Hi-tech Application Centre for Agriculture. Under this model, vegetables and fruit were planted in glasshouses with automated irrigation systems and the cultivation confirmed to VIETGAP (Vietnamese Good Agricultural Practices) standards. The model has earned farmers profits of VNĐ90-100 million ($3,960-4,400) per hectare, much higher than the VNĐ50-60 million ($2,200-2,640) they would earn normally. Robotics, high-tech treatment improves medical care in VN
Bình Dân Hospital’s annual scientific conference highlighted the latest high-tech techniques in surgery and medical treatment. —Photo courtesy of Bình Dân Hospital Viet Nam News HCM CITY — High-tech treatments have become an efficient coworker for doctors in diagnosis and treatment in Việt Nam, Trần Vĩnh Hưng, the director of Bình Dân Hospital, said at a conference held in HCM City on Saturday. Speaking at the opening ceremony of the hospital’s annual scientific conference, Hưng said that progress in treating disease had had a significant improvement on the survival rates and the quality of patients’ life. The hospital has been a pioneer in Việt Nam in using robots in minimally invasive surgeries to treat 14 kinds of disease and cancer. Through a magnified 3D high-definition vision system, surgeons can direct the robot’s hands to bend and rotate 540 degrees, far more than a human hand can. Vĩnh Long Province gets hi-tech hospital
Xuyên Á General Hospital on October 20 officially opened its branch in the Mekong Delta province of Vĩnh Long. VNS Photo Viet Nam News VĨNH LONG — Xuyên Á General Hospital on Saturday opened a branch in the Mekong Delta province of Vĩnh Long that provides affordable high-tech healthcare services to residents. Construction on the 10-storey hospital started in October 2016. The facility has 1,183 beds for inpatients, and a staff of experienced doctors. The hospital has 28 departments, including interventional cardiology, open heart surgery, neurology, and spinal disorders. With total capital of VNĐ1.1 trillion (US$47.1 million), the hospital had a soft opening in August. After two months of operation, the number of insured patients accounted for nearly 75 per cent. It now has about 2,000 outpatients and about 800 inpatients per day. More than 20 patients with brain injuries due to traffic accidents have been saved by the hospital’s doctors.
